زمینه فرهنگی
In the Levant, people often use 'Akeed' (أكيد) with a very long 'ee' sound for emphasis. While 'Bi-t-ta'kid' is understood, 'Akeed' is the heartbeat of daily conversation. In the Gulf, 'Abshir' (أبشر) is often used alongside 'بالتأكيد' when responding to a request. It means 'consider it done' and is extremely polite. Egyptians might use 'Tab'an' (طبعاً) more frequently than 'Bi-t-ta'kid'. If you use 'Bi-t-ta'kid' in Cairo, you will sound very educated or like you work in a high-end hotel. In North Africa, Modern Standard Arabic phrases like 'بالتأكيد' are used in media and education, but in Darija (dialect), they might use 'Bes-sah' or 'Ma'loum'.
The 'Shadda' Secret
Always double the 'T' sound. If you say 'bi-al-takid', you sound like a beginner. Say 'bit-ta'kid' to sound like a native.

What It Means
بالتأكيد is your go-to word for absolute certainty. It comes from the root word for 'confirming' or 'assuring.' When you use it, you are telling the other person that there is zero percent doubt in your mind. It is the verbal equivalent of a firm handshake or a solid nod.
How To Use It
You can use it as a standalone answer or at the start of a sentence. If a friend asks if you are coming to dinner, just say بالتأكيد. It sounds polished and clear. You do not need to conjugate it or change it for gender. It is a 'plug and play' expression that makes you sound very fluent and decisive.
When To Use It
Use it when you want to show enthusiasm or professional reliability. In a meeting, it shows you are on top of your tasks. At a restaurant, use it to confirm your order to the waiter. It is perfect for texting when you want to sound more supportive than a simple 'yes.' It works beautifully when someone asks for a favor and you want to say 'gladly.'
When NOT To Use It
Avoid it if you are actually unsure about something. If you say بالتأكيد and then do not show up, it looks worse than a simple 'maybe.' Do not use it in very high-intensity emotional arguments where it might sound sarcastic. Also, in very thick street slang, it might sound a bit 'proper,' like wearing a blazer to a beach party.
Cultural Background
Arabic culture places a high value on hospitality and commitment. Using a strong word like بالتأكيد reflects the 'Karam' (generosity) of spirit. It is not just about the facts; it is about honoring the person you are talking to. It gained massive popularity through Modern Standard Arabic media and news, making it a universal bridge between different dialects.
Common Variations
You will often hear أكيد in daily life. That is the shorter, cooler younger brother of بالتأكيد. In the Levant, people might say طبعاً (of course). However, بالتأكيد remains the gold standard for being clear and respectful across the entire Arab world.

مثالها
7هل ستأتي إلى العشاء؟ بالتأكيد!
Are you coming to dinner? Definitely!
A warm and enthusiastic way to accept an invite.
سأرسل التقرير اليوم بالتأكيد.
I will definitely send the report today.
Shows professional reliability and commitment.
بالتأكيد، هذا الفيلم رائع جداً.
Definitely, this movie is very wonderful.
Used to validate someone else's point of view.
بالتأكيد، نلتقي هناك.
For sure, let's meet there.
Short, clear, and easy to type.
هل تريد القهوة الآن؟ بالتأكيد يا سيدي.
Do you want the coffee now? Certainly, sir.
Polite service language.
هل تحب الشوكولاتة؟ بالتأكيد، من لا يحبها؟
Do you like chocolate? Definitely, who doesn't?
Using the phrase to highlight something obvious.
سأكون بجانبك بالتأكيد.
I will definitely be by your side.
Provides strong emotional support.
